Overall Meaning

The Devlins's song "Drift" tackles the theme of drifting apart in a relationship. The first verse describes the singer's feelings of detachment and seeking independence, "Out of my head, out on my own. Sometimes I understand this life we've been shown through." However, as the chorus suggests, this newfound independence has caused the relationship to drift apart, leaving the singer feeling heavy and difficult to lift. The lyrics reflect a sense of frustration as the singer wonders where their partner will go and whether they will be left alone to drift through life aimlessly.


The second verse picks up the hopelessness of the situation as the singer is consumed by waiting for their partner after they suggest that they should go, "And somewhere along the thin white line, I'm spending my days and nights waiting for you to show. You say what you want to say..." The frustration and uncertainty are palpable as the singer questions where their partner will go and whether they will come back.


Overall, "Drift" is a poignant portrayal of the complexities of relationships and how the pursuit of independence can sometimes cause people to drift apart. The lyrics are well-crafted and evoke a sense of melancholy and longing for something that feels just out of reach.
